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Terra Delyssa Extra Virgin Olive Oil 750ml
Results for
Terra Delyssa Extra Virgin Olive Oil 750ml
Related Searches
terra delyssa extra virgin olive oil 750ml
terra delyssa extra virgin olive oil costco
terra delyssa tunisian extra virgin olive oil
terra delyssa olive oil
terra delyssa olive oil where to buy
terra delyssa olive oil walmart
terra delyssa olive oil review
terra delyssa olive oil real
how good is terra delyssa olive oil
terra delyssa organic olive oil